What Is Outfit Layering for Video Content
Outfit layering for video content is the deliberate styling of multiple clothing pieces in a way that translates beautifully on camera. It involves combining textures, proportions, colors, and silhouettes so that every piece contributes to a visually rich frame. Unlike traditional layering meant purely for warmth, video-focused layering prioritizes camera-friendly contrast, movement, and transformation potential.
Key Elements of Camera-Ready Layering
- Contrast in texture: Pair knits with leather, silk with denim, or mesh with cotton to create tactile interest on screen.Varied lengths: Mix cropped jackets with longer tops or tunics with shorter outerwear to produce visual hierarchy.Color blocking: Use intentional color separation between layers so each piece reads clearly on small mobile screens.Movement-friendly fabrics: Choose materials that flow, drape, or catch light to add dynamic energy to your footage.

How to Use Outfit Layering for Video Content on TikTok, Reels, and Shorts
Each platform rewards slightly different pacing, but the core principles of outfit layering for video content remain consistent. Here is how to adapt your layered looks for maximum impact on every major short-form platform.
TikTok Strategy
TikTok thrives on transformation content. Use layering to create before-and-after moments with simple jump cuts. Start with your heaviest outer layer fully on, then progressively reveal base layers with each beat drop or transition. Pair this with trending sounds and you have a formula that consistently performs.
Instagram Reels Strategy
Instagram favors aspirational aesthetics and polished styling. Lean into refined layering combinations such as tailored blazers over slip dresses or chunky cardigans over crisp button-downs. Use carousel-style reveals where each swipe or cut exposes a new layer of detail.
YouTube Shorts Strategy
YouTube Shorts audiences appreciate educational depth. Combine outfit layering for video content with quick verbal explanations of why you styled each piece a certain way. This positions you as an authority while still delivering the satisfying visual reveals that drive completion rate.
Pro Tips for Mastering Outfit Layering on Camera
- Plan your transitions: Before filming, decide which layers you will remove and in what order. This prevents awkward fumbling on camera.Mind the silhouette: Ensure that removing a layer still leaves a complete, flattering outfit. Never let a reveal look unfinished.Use lighting to your advantage: Layered textures photograph beautifully under natural light or soft ring lights, especially when fabrics have sheen or dimension.Coordinate your color palette: Stick to two to four harmonious tones so layering reads as intentional rather than cluttered.Accessorize strategically: Belts, scarves, and jewelry can act as removable layers too, adding another dimension to your reveals.Test your angles: Some layering combinations look better from specific camera positions. Film a quick test before committing to a full take.
Common Layering Mistakes to Avoid
Even experienced creators make errors when styling outfit layering for video content. Avoid bulky combinations that lose definition on camera, clashing prints that compete for attention, and layering pieces that wrinkle easily. Always press or steam your garments before filming, since fabric creases become highly visible under bright lighting.
